Steelhead
Steelhead, or occasionally steelhead trout, is the common name of the anadromous form of the coastal rainbow trout or redband trout (O. m. gairdneri). Steelhead are native to cold-water tributaries of the Pacific basin in Northeast Asia and North America. Like other sea-run (anadromous) trout and salmon, steelhead spawn in freshwater, smolts migrate to the ocean to forage for several years and adults return to their natal streams to spawn. Steelhead are iteroparous, although survival is approximately 10–20%. Description The freshwater form of the steelhead is the rainbow trout (''Oncorhynchus mykiss''). The difference between these forms of the species is that steelhead migrate to the ocean and return to freshwater tributaries to spawn, whereas non-anadromous rainbow trout do not leave freshwater. Rainbow Trout
The rainbow trout (''Oncorhynchus mykiss'') is a species of trout native to cold-water tributaries of the Pacific Ocean in Asia and North America. The steelhead (sometimes called "steelhead trout") is an anadromous (sea-run) form of the coastal rainbow trout or Columbia River redband trout that usually returns to freshwater to spawn after living two to three years in the ocean. Freshwater forms that have been introduced into the Great Lakes and migrate into tributaries to spawn are also called steelhead. Adult freshwater stream rainbow trout average between , while lake-dwelling and anadromous forms may reach . Coloration varies widely based on subspecies, forms, and habitat. Adult fish are distinguished by a broad reddish stripe along the lateral line, from gills to the tail, which is most vivid in breeding males. Salmon
Salmon () is the common name for several commercially important species of euryhaline ray-finned fish from the family Salmonidae, which are native to tributaries of the North Atlantic (genus ''Salmo'') and North Pacific (genus '' Oncorhynchus'') basin. Other closely related fish in the same family include trout, char, grayling, whitefish, lenok and taimen. Salmon are typically anadromous: they hatch in the gravel beds of shallow fresh water streams, migrate to the ocean as adults and live like sea fish, then return to fresh water to reproduce. However, populations of several species are restricted to fresh water throughout their lives. Folklore has it that the fish return to the exact spot where they hatched to spawn, and tracking studies have shown this to be mostly true. Trout
Trout are species of freshwater fish belonging to the genera '' Oncorhynchus'', '' Salmo'' and '' Salvelinus'', all of the subfamily Salmoninae of the family Salmonidae. The word ''trout'' is also used as part of the name of some non-salmonid fish such as ''Cynoscion nebulosus'', the spotted seatrout or speckled trout. Trout are closely related to salmon and char (or charr): species termed salmon and char occur in the same genera as do fish called trout (''Oncorhynchus'' – Pacific salmon and trout, ''Salmo'' – Atlantic salmon and various trout, ''Salvelinus'' – char and trout). Lake trout and most other trout live in freshwater lakes and rivers exclusively, while there are others, such as the steelhead, a form of the coastal rainbow trout, that can spend two or three years at sea before returning to fresh water to spawn (a habit more typical of salmon). Juvenile Salmon
Fish go through various life stages between fertilization and adulthood. The life of a fish start as spawned eggs which hatch into immotile larvae. These larval hatchlings are not yet capable of feeding themselves and carry a yolk sac which provides stored nutrition. Before the yolk sac completely disappears, the young fish must mature enough to be able to forage independently. When they have developed to the point where they are capable of feeding by themselves, the fish are called fry. When, in addition, they have developed scales and working fins, the transition to a juvenile fish is complete and it is called a fingerling, so called as they are typically about the size of human fingers. The juvenile stage lasts until the fish is fully grown, sexually mature and interacting with other adult fish. Fish Migration
Fish migration is mass relocation by fish from one area or body of water to another. Many types of fish migrate on a regular basis, on time scales ranging from daily to annually or longer, and over distances ranging from a few metres to thousands of kilometres. Such migrations are usually done for better feeding or to reproduce, but in other cases the reasons are unclear. Fish migrations involve movements of schools of fish on a scale and duration larger than those arising during normal daily activities. Some particular types of migration are ''anadromous'', in which adult fish live in the sea and migrate into fresh water to spawn; and ''catadromous'', in which adult fish live in fresh water and migrate into salt water to spawn. Marine forage fish often make large migrations between their spawning, feeding and nursery grounds. Spawn (biology)
Spawn is the eggs and sperm released or deposited into water by aquatic animals. As a verb, ''to spawn'' refers to the process of releasing the eggs and sperm, and the act of both sexes is called spawning. Most aquatic animals, except for aquatic mammals and reptiles, reproduce through the process of spawning. Spawn consists of the reproductive cells (gametes) of many aquatic animals, some of which will become fertilized and produce offspring. The process of spawning typically involves females releasing ova (unfertilized eggs) into the water, often in large quantities, while males simultaneously or sequentially release spermatozoa ( milt) to fertilize the eggs. Johann Julius Walbaum
Johann Julius Walbaum (30 June 1724 – 21 August 1799) was a German physician, natural history, naturalist and fauna taxonomist. Works As an ichthyologist, he was the first to describe many previously unknown fish species from remote parts of the globe, such as the Barracuda, Great Barracuda (''Sphyraena barracuda''), the Chum salmon (''Oncorhynchus keta'') from the Kamchatka River in Siberia, and the curimatá-pacú (''Prochilodus marggravii'') from the São Francisco River in Brazil. He was also the first to observe gloves as a preventative against infection in medical surgery. In 1758, the gloves he observed were made from the cecum of the sheep, rather than rubber, which had not yet been discovered.
